当前位置:首页 > 三角洲行动无畏契约pubg机器修复解除标记绝地求生频繁24电脑 > 正文

三角洲行动,聪明解码机器码的诀窍,三角洲行动:聪明解码机器码的诀窍,三角洲机器人怎么样

摘要: 在当今数字化飞速发展的时代,计算机技术已经渗透到我们生活的方方面面,而机器码作为计算机底层的指令代码,对于计算机系统的运行和程序...

在当今数字化飞速发展的时代,计算机技术已经渗透到我们生活的方方面面,而机器码作为计算机底层的指令代码,对于计算机系统的运行和程序的执行起着至关重要的作用,对于那些热衷于计算机技术、渴望深入了解计算机内部运作机制的人来说,掌握解码机器码的诀窍无疑是一项极具挑战性但又极具吸引力的任务,而“三角洲行动”,作为一场关于解码机器码的智慧之旅,将带领我们揭开这一神秘领域的面纱,探寻聪明解码机器码的诀窍。

三角洲行动,聪明解码机器码的诀窍,三角洲行动:聪明解码机器码的诀窍,三角洲机器人怎么样

初识机器码与三角洲行动的背景

机器码,简单来说就是计算机能够直接识别和执行的二进制代码,它是计算机硬件与软件之间沟通的桥梁,每一条机器码都对应着一个特定的计算机指令,这些指令控制着计算机的各种操作,如数据的读取、存储、运算等,机器码的编写和解读对于大多数人来说是一项晦涩难懂的任务,就像是一座矗立在技术高峰上的神秘城堡,让人望而生畏。

“三角洲行动”正是在这样的背景下应运而生,这一行动旨在帮助那些有志于解码机器码的人,提供一系列系统的方法和技巧,让他们能够逐步踏入机器码解码的神秘领域,它就像是一把开启机器码解码之门的钥匙,为那些渴望探索计算机底层奥秘的人指明了方向。

聪明解码机器码的基础准备

1、了解计算机硬件基础

要想成功解码机器码,首先需要对计算机的硬件基础有一个清晰的认识,这包括了解计算机的中央处理器(CPU)、内存、硬盘等主要硬件组件的工作原理和功能,CPU 是计算机的“大脑”,它负责执行机器码指令,内存则用于存储程序和数据,硬盘则用于长期存储数据,只有对这些硬件基础有了深入的了解,才能更好地理解机器码在计算机系统中的作用和运行机制。

2、掌握编程语言基础

虽然机器码是二进制代码,但在实际解码过程中,我们往往需要借助编程语言来辅助我们进行分析和解读,掌握一门编程语言的基础知识是非常必要的,常见的编程语言如 C、C++、Python 等都可以用于机器码解码,它们提供了丰富的函数和库,能够帮助我们更方便地处理机器码数据。

3、熟悉调试工具

在解码机器码的过程中,调试工具是我们的得力助手,这些工具可以帮助我们跟踪程序的执行过程,查看寄存器的值、内存中的数据等信息,从而帮助我们定位和解决解码过程中遇到的问题,常见的调试工具如 GDB、OllyDbg 等都具有强大的调试功能,能够满足我们的解码需求。

聪明解码机器码的关键技巧

1、从简单到复杂

解码机器码是一个循序渐进的过程,我们不能一开始就试图解码复杂的机器码程序,而应该从简单的程序入手,逐步积累经验和技巧,可以选择一些简单的汇编语言程序,通过反汇编工具将其转换为机器码,然后逐步分析每一条机器码的含义和作用,随着经验的积累,再逐渐挑战更复杂的程序。

2、善于利用反汇编工具

反汇编工具是解码机器码的重要利器,它们可以将机器码程序转换为汇编语言代码,让我们能够更直观地理解程序的结构和逻辑,常见的反汇编工具如 IDA Pro、WinDbg 等都具有强大的反汇编功能,能够帮助我们快速定位和分析机器码程序中的关键代码,在使用反汇编工具时,我们需要善于利用它们提供的各种功能,如查看函数调用关系、查看内存中的数据等,从而更好地理解机器码程序的运行机制。

3、理解指令集架构

不同的计算机系统具有不同的指令集架构,这就像是不同的语言有着不同的语法规则一样,要想成功解码机器码,我们需要深入理解所使用计算机系统的指令集架构,了解每一条指令的功能和用法,可以通过查阅相关的指令集手册、阅读相关的技术文献等方式来加深对指令集架构的理解。

4、善于分析寄存器和内存数据

在解码机器码的过程中,寄存器和内存数据是我们关注的重点,寄存器是 CPU 内部用于存储临时数据的存储单元,它们的状态和值直接反映了程序的执行情况,内存则用于存储程序和数据,我们可以通过查看内存中的数据来了解程序的运行状态和数据的存储情况,我们需要善于分析寄存器和内存数据,从中寻找解码的线索和突破口。

5、结合调试信息进行分析

调试信息是我们解码机器码的重要参考依据,它们可以帮助我们了解程序的执行流程、变量的值等信息,在解码过程中,我们可以结合调试信息进行分析,通过跟踪程序的执行过程来确定每一条机器码的含义和作用,我们还可以利用调试信息来定位和解决解码过程中遇到的问题,提高解码的效率和准确性。

三角洲行动中的实战案例

1、破解简单的加密算法

在实际应用中,很多程序都采用了加密算法来保护其数据和功能,我们可以选择一些简单的加密算法,如凯撒密码、移位密码等,通过解码机器码来破解这些加密算法,在破解过程中,我们可以利用反汇编工具和调试工具来分析加密算法的实现原理,找出加密和解密的关键代码,从而实现对加密算法的破解。

2、修复损坏的可执行文件

我们可能会遇到损坏的可执行文件,这些文件无法正常运行,我们可以利用解码机器码的技巧来修复这些损坏的可执行文件,通过反汇编工具和调试工具,我们可以分析可执行文件的结构和逻辑,找出损坏的代码段和数据段,然后进行修复,在修复过程中,我们需要注意保持可执行文件的兼容性和稳定性,避免对原文件造成进一步的损坏。

3、逆向工程恶意软件

恶意软件是计算机安全领域的一大威胁,它们往往采用各种加密和混淆技术来隐藏自己的真实面目,我们可以利用解码机器码的技巧来逆向工程恶意软件,分析其恶意行为和功能,通过反汇编工具和调试工具,我们可以分析恶意软件的代码结构和逻辑,找出其恶意功能的实现原理,从而为计算机安全防御提供有力的支持。

“三角洲行动”为我们提供了一条聪明解码机器码的捷径,通过掌握解码机器码的基础准备、关键技巧以及实战案例,我们能够逐步揭开机器码解码的神秘面纱,深入了解计算机底层的运行机制,机器码解码是一个不断发展和变化的领域,随着计算机技术的不断进步,新的加密算法、反调试技术等不断涌现,这就要求我们不断学习和更新知识,掌握新的解码技巧和方法。

展望未来,随着人工智能、机器学习等技术的不断发展,机器码解码可能会迎来新的变革和突破,我们可以想象,未来的机器码解码将更加智能化、自动化,能够帮助我们更快速、更准确地解码复杂的机器码程序,随着计算机安全领域的不断发展,机器码解码也将在计算机安全防御中发挥更加重要的作用,为保护计算机系统和用户数据提供有力的支持。

“三角洲行动”是一场充满挑战和机遇的技术之旅,它让我们能够深入了解计算机底层的奥秘,掌握聪明解码机器码的诀窍,为我们的计算机技术之路增添了一抹亮丽的色彩,让我们怀揣着对技术的热爱和追求,踏上“三角洲行动”的征程,去探索那未知的机器码世界吧。